* [PATCH 2/8] st: do not allocate a gendisk
2021-08-12 7:46 ` Christoph Hellwig
@ 2021-08-12 7:46 ` Christoph Hellwig
-1 siblings, 0 replies; 20+ messages in thread
From: Christoph Hellwig @ 2021-08-12 7:46 UTC (permalink / raw
To: Jens Axboe
Cc: Stefan Haberland, Jan Hoeppner, Martin K. Petersen, Doug Gilbert,
Kai Mäkisara, Luis Chamberlain, linux-block, linux-nvme,
linux-s390, linux-scsi
st is a character driver and thus does not need to allocate a gendisk,
which is only used for file system-like block layer I/O on block
devices.
Signed-off-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
---
drivers/scsi/st.c | 49 ++++++++++++-----------------------------------
drivers/scsi/st.h | 2 +-
2 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 38 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/scsi/st.c b/drivers/scsi/st.c
index c6f14540ae03..d1abc020f3c0 100644
--- a/drivers/scsi/st.c
+++ b/drivers/scsi/st.c
@@ -309,13 +309,8 @@ static char * st_incompatible(struct scsi_device* SDp)
}
\f
-static inline char *tape_name(struct scsi_tape *tape)
-{
- return tape->disk->disk_name;
-}
-
#define st_printk(prefix, t, fmt, a...) \
- sdev_prefix_printk(prefix, (t)->device, tape_name(t), fmt, ##a)
+ sdev_prefix_printk(prefix, (t)->device, (t)->name, fmt, ##a)
#ifdef DEBUG
#define DEBC_printk(t, fmt, a...) \
if (debugging) { st_printk(ST_DEB_MSG, t, fmt, ##a ); }
@@ -363,7 +358,7 @@ static int st_chk_result(struct scsi_tape *STp, struct st_request * SRpnt)
int result = SRpnt->result;
u8 scode;
DEB(const char *stp;)
- char *name = tape_name(STp);
+ char *name = STp->name;
struct st_cmdstatus *cmdstatp;
if (!result)
@@ -3841,8 +3836,9 @@ static long st_ioctl_common(struct file *file, unsigned int cmd_in, void __user
!capable(CAP_SYS_RAWIO))
i = -EPERM;
else
- i = scsi_cmd_ioctl(STp->disk->queue, STp->disk,
- file->f_mode, cmd_in, p);
+ i = scsi_cmd_ioctl(STp->device->request_queue,
+ NULL, file->f_mode, cmd_in,
+ p);
if (i != -ENOTTY)
return i;
break;
@@ -4216,7 +4212,7 @@ static int create_one_cdev(struct scsi_tape *tape, int mode, int rew)
i = mode << (4 - ST_NBR_MODE_BITS);
snprintf(name, 10, "%s%s%s", rew ? "n" : "",
- tape->disk->disk_name, st_formats[i]);
+ tape->name, st_formats[i]);
dev = device_create(&st_sysfs_class, &tape->device->sdev_gendev,
cdev_devno, &tape->modes[mode], "%s", name);
@@ -4271,7 +4267,6 @@ static void remove_cdevs(struct scsi_tape *tape)
static int st_probe(struct device *dev)
{
struct scsi_device *SDp = to_scsi_device(dev);
- struct gendisk *disk = NULL;
struct scsi_tape *tpnt = NULL;
struct st_modedef *STm;
struct st_partstat *STps;
@@ -4301,27 +4296,13 @@ static int st_probe(struct device *dev)
goto out;
}
- disk = alloc_disk(1);
- if (!disk) {
- sdev_printk(KERN_ERR, SDp,
- "st: out of memory. Device not attached.\n");
- goto out_buffer_free;
- }
-
tpnt = kzalloc(sizeof(struct scsi_tape), GFP_KERNEL);
if (tpnt == NULL) {
sdev_printk(KERN_ERR, SDp,
"st: Can't allocate device descriptor.\n");
- goto out_put_disk;
+ goto out_buffer_free;
}
kref_init(&tpnt->kref);
- tpnt->disk = disk;
- disk->private_data = &tpnt->driver;
- /* SCSI tape doesn't register this gendisk via add_disk(). Manually
- * take queue reference that release_disk() expects. */
- if (!blk_get_queue(SDp->request_queue))
- goto out_put_disk;
- disk->queue = SDp->request_queue;
tpnt->driver = &st_template;
tpnt->device = SDp;
@@ -4394,10 +4375,10 @@ static int st_probe(struct device *dev)
idr_preload_end();
if (error < 0) {
pr_warn("st: idr allocation failed: %d\n", error);
- goto out_put_queue;
+ goto out_free_tape;
}
tpnt->index = error;
- sprintf(disk->disk_name, "st%d", tpnt->index);
+ sprintf(tpnt->name, "st%d", tpnt->index);
tpnt->stats = kzalloc(sizeof(struct scsi_tape_stats), GFP_KERNEL);
if (tpnt->stats == NULL) {
sdev_printk(KERN_ERR, SDp,
@@ -4414,9 +4395,9 @@ static int st_probe(struct device *dev)
scsi_autopm_put_device(SDp);
sdev_printk(KERN_NOTICE, SDp,
- "Attached scsi tape %s\n", tape_name(tpnt));
+ "Attached scsi tape %s\n", tpnt->name);
sdev_printk(KERN_INFO, SDp, "%s: try direct i/o: %s (alignment %d B)\n",
- tape_name(tpnt), tpnt->try_dio ? "yes" : "no",
+ tpnt->name, tpnt->try_dio ? "yes" : "no",
queue_dma_alignment(SDp->request_queue) + 1);
return 0;
@@ -4428,10 +4409,7 @@ static int st_probe(struct device *dev)
spin_lock(&st_index_lock);
idr_remove(&st_index_idr, tpnt->index);
spin_unlock(&st_index_lock);
-out_put_queue:
- blk_put_queue(disk->queue);
-out_put_disk:
- put_disk(disk);
+out_free_tape:
kfree(tpnt);
out_buffer_free:
kfree(buffer);
@@ -4470,7 +4448,6 @@ static int st_remove(struct device *dev)
static void scsi_tape_release(struct kref *kref)
{
struct scsi_tape *tpnt = to_scsi_tape(kref);
- struct gendisk *disk = tpnt->disk;
tpnt->device = NULL;
@@ -4480,8 +4457,6 @@ static void scsi_tape_release(struct kref *kref)
kfree(tpnt->buffer);
}
- disk->private_data = NULL;
- put_disk(disk);
kfree(tpnt->stats);
kfree(tpnt);
return;
diff --git a/drivers/scsi/st.h b/drivers/scsi/st.h
index 9d3c38bb0794..c0ef0d9aaf8a 100644
--- a/drivers/scsi/st.h
+++ b/drivers/scsi/st.h
@@ -187,7 +187,7 @@ struct scsi_tape {
unsigned char last_cmnd[6];
unsigned char last_sense[16];
#endif
- struct gendisk *disk;
+ char name[DISK_NAME_LEN];
struct kref kref;
struct scsi_tape_stats *stats;
};
--
2.30.2

* [PATCH 4/8] block: cleanup the lockdep handling in *alloc_disk
2021-08-12 7:46 ` Christoph Hellwig
@ 2021-08-12 7:46 ` Christoph Hellwig
-1 siblings, 0 replies; 20+ messages in thread
From: Christoph Hellwig @ 2021-08-12 7:46 UTC (permalink / raw
To: Jens Axboe
Cc: Stefan Haberland, Jan Hoeppner, Martin K. Petersen, Doug Gilbert,
Kai Mäkisara, Luis Chamberlain, linux-block, linux-nvme,
linux-s390, linux-scsi
Pass the lockdep name to the low-level __blk_alloc_disk helper and
hardcode the name for it given that the number of minors or node_id
are not very useful information. While this passes a pointless
argument for non-lockdep builds that is not really an issue as
disk allocation is a probe time only slow path.
Signed-off-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
---
block/blk-mq.c | 5 +++--
block/genhd.c | 8 +++++---
include/linux/blk-mq.h | 10 +++-------
include/linux/genhd.h | 23 ++++++-----------------
4 files changed, 17 insertions(+), 29 deletions(-)
diff --git a/block/blk-mq.c b/block/blk-mq.c
index 2c4ac51e54eb..f7e9e8d84d4a 100644
--- a/block/blk-mq.c
+++ b/block/blk-mq.c
@@ -3133,7 +3133,8 @@ struct request_queue *blk_mq_init_queue(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set)
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(blk_mq_init_queue);
-struct gendisk *__blk_mq_alloc_disk(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set, void *queuedata)
+struct gendisk *__blk_mq_alloc_disk(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set, void *queuedata,
+ struct lock_class_key *lkclass)
{
struct request_queue *q;
struct gendisk *disk;
@@ -3142,7 +3143,7 @@ struct gendisk *__blk_mq_alloc_disk(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set, void *queuedata)
if (IS_ERR(q))
return ERR_CAST(q);
- disk = __alloc_disk_node(0, set->numa_node);
+ disk = __alloc_disk_node(0, set->numa_node, lkclass);
if (!disk) {
blk_cleanup_queue(q);
return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
diff --git a/block/genhd.c b/block/genhd.c
index 9021c8ce3869..3e2bc52013ca 100644
--- a/block/genhd.c
+++ b/block/genhd.c
@@ -1263,7 +1263,8 @@ dev_t blk_lookup_devt(const char *name, int partno)
return devt;
}
-struct gendisk *__alloc_disk_node(int minors, int node_id)
+struct gendisk *__alloc_disk_node(int minors, int node_id,
+ struct lock_class_key *lkclass)
{
struct gendisk *disk;
@@ -1287,6 +1288,7 @@ struct gendisk *__alloc_disk_node(int minors, int node_id)
disk_to_dev(disk)->type = &disk_type;
device_initialize(disk_to_dev(disk));
inc_diskseq(disk);
+ lockdep_init_map(&disk->lockdep_map, "(bio completion)", lkclass, 0);
return disk;
@@ -1299,7 +1301,7 @@ struct gendisk *__alloc_disk_node(int minors, int node_id)
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(__alloc_disk_node);
-struct gendisk *__blk_alloc_disk(int node)
+struct gendisk *__blk_alloc_disk(int node, struct lock_class_key *lkclass)
{
struct request_queue *q;
struct gendisk *disk;
@@ -1308,7 +1310,7 @@ struct gendisk *__blk_alloc_disk(int node)
if (!q)
return NULL;
- disk = __alloc_disk_node(0, node);
+ disk = __alloc_disk_node(0, node, lkclass);
if (!disk) {
blk_cleanup_queue(q);
return NULL;
diff --git a/include/linux/blk-mq.h b/include/linux/blk-mq.h
index 22215db36122..13ba1861e688 100644
--- a/include/linux/blk-mq.h
+++ b/include/linux/blk-mq.h
@@ -432,18 +432,14 @@ enum {
((policy & ((1 << BLK_MQ_F_ALLOC_POLICY_BITS) - 1)) \
<< BLK_MQ_F_ALLOC_POLICY_START_BIT)
+struct gendisk *__blk_mq_alloc_disk(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set, void *queuedata,
+ struct lock_class_key *lkclass);
#define blk_mq_alloc_disk(set, queuedata) \
({ \
static struct lock_class_key __key; \
- struct gendisk *__disk = __blk_mq_alloc_disk(set, queuedata); \
\
- if (!IS_ERR(__disk)) \
- lockdep_init_map(&__disk->lockdep_map, \
- "(bio completion)", &__key, 0); \
- __disk; \
+ __blk_mq_alloc_disk(set, queuedata, &__key); \
})
-struct gendisk *__blk_mq_alloc_disk(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set,
- void *queuedata);
struct request_queue *blk_mq_init_queue(struct blk_mq_tag_set *);
int blk_mq_init_allocated_queue(struct blk_mq_tag_set *set,
struct request_queue *q);
diff --git a/include/linux/genhd.h b/include/linux/genhd.h
index ddd02def1ed4..031051057e13 100644
--- a/include/linux/genhd.h
+++ b/include/linux/genhd.h
@@ -262,27 +262,21 @@ static inline sector_t get_capacity(struct gendisk *disk)
int bdev_disk_changed(struct gendisk *disk, bool invalidate);
void blk_drop_partitions(struct gendisk *disk);
-extern struct gendisk *__alloc_disk_node(int minors, int node_id);
+struct gendisk *__alloc_disk_node(int minors, int node_id,
+ struct lock_class_key *lkclass);
extern void put_disk(struct gendisk *disk);
#define alloc_disk_node(minors, node_id) \
({ \
static struct lock_class_key __key; \
- const char *__name; \
- struct gendisk *__disk; \
\
- __name = "(gendisk_completion)"#minors"("#node_id")"; \
- \
- __disk = __alloc_disk_node(minors, node_id); \
- \
- if (__disk) \
- lockdep_init_map(&__disk->lockdep_map, __name, &__key, 0); \
- \
- __disk; \
+ __alloc_disk_node(minors, node_id, &__key); \
})
#define alloc_disk(minors) alloc_disk_node(minors, NUMA_NO_NODE)
+struct gendisk *__blk_alloc_disk(int node, struct lock_class_key *lkclass);
+
/**
* blk_alloc_disk - allocate a gendisk structure
* @node_id: numa node to allocate on
@@ -294,15 +288,10 @@ extern void put_disk(struct gendisk *disk);
*/
#define blk_alloc_disk(node_id) \
({ \
- struct gendisk *__disk = __blk_alloc_disk(node_id); \
static struct lock_class_key __key; \
\
- if (__disk) \
- lockdep_init_map(&__disk->lockdep_map, \
- "(bio completion)", &__key, 0); \
- __disk; \
+ __blk_alloc_disk(node_id, &__key); \
})
-struct gendisk *__blk_alloc_disk(int node);
void blk_cleanup_disk(struct gendisk *disk);
int __register_blkdev(unsigned int major, const char *name,
--
2.30.2

* [PATCH 8/8] block: hold a request_queue reference for the lifetime of struct gendisk
2021-08-12 7:46 ` Christoph Hellwig
@ 2021-08-12 7:46 ` Christoph Hellwig
-1 siblings, 0 replies; 20+ messages in thread
From: Christoph Hellwig @ 2021-08-12 7:46 UTC (permalink / raw
To: Jens Axboe
Cc: Stefan Haberland, Jan Hoeppner, Martin K. Petersen, Doug Gilbert,
Kai Mäkisara, Luis Chamberlain, linux-block, linux-nvme,
linux-s390, linux-scsi
Acquire the queue ref dropped in disk_release in __blk_alloc_disk so any
allocate gendisk always has a queue reference.
Signed-off-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
---
block/genhd.c | 20 +++++++-------------
include/linux/genhd.h | 1 -
2 files changed, 7 insertions(+), 14 deletions(-)
diff --git a/block/genhd.c b/block/genhd.c
index 283cf0c649e1..18600f682edb 100644
--- a/block/genhd.c
+++ b/block/genhd.c
@@ -544,16 +544,6 @@ static void __device_add_disk(struct device *parent, struct gendisk *disk,
register_disk(parent, disk, groups);
if (register_queue)
blk_register_queue(disk);
-
- /*
- * Take an extra ref on queue which will be put on disk_release()
- * so that it sticks around as long as @disk is there.
- */
- if (blk_get_queue(disk->queue))
- set_bit(GD_QUEUE_REF, &disk->state);
- else
- WARN_ON_ONCE(1);
-
disk_add_events(disk);
blk_integrity_add(disk);
}
@@ -1096,8 +1086,7 @@ static void disk_release(struct device *dev)
disk_release_events(disk);
kfree(disk->random);
xa_destroy(&disk->part_tbl);
- if (test_bit(GD_QUEUE_REF, &disk->state) && disk->queue)
- blk_put_queue(disk->queue);
+ blk_put_queue(disk->queue);
iput(disk->part0->bd_inode); /* frees the disk */
}
@@ -1268,9 +1257,12 @@ struct gendisk *__alloc_disk_node(struct request_queue *q, int node_id,
{
struct gendisk *disk;
+ if (!blk_get_queue(q))
+ return NULL;
+
disk = kzalloc_node(sizeof(struct gendisk), GFP_KERNEL, node_id);
if (!disk)
- return NULL;
+ goto out_put_queue;
disk->part0 = bdev_alloc(disk, 0);
if (!disk->part0)
@@ -1297,6 +1289,8 @@ struct gendisk *__alloc_disk_node(struct request_queue *q, int node_id,
iput(disk->part0->bd_inode);
out_free_disk:
kfree(disk);
+out_put_queue:
+ blk_put_queue(q);
return NULL;
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(__alloc_disk_node);
diff --git a/include/linux/genhd.h b/include/linux/genhd.h
index 875be3bc8afb..e94147613d01 100644
--- a/include/linux/genhd.h
+++ b/include/linux/genhd.h
@@ -149,7 +149,6 @@ struct gendisk {
unsigned long state;
#define GD_NEED_PART_SCAN 0
#define GD_READ_ONLY 1
-#define GD_QUEUE_REF 2
struct mutex open_mutex; /* open/close mutex */
unsigned open_partitions; /* number of open partitions */
--
2.30.2
